LongeviQuest is pleased to announce the age validation of Ruth Catherine Dodd of the United States at age 110. She was born in Eldon, Missouri, United States on 2 July 1909. She was the eldest of 3 siblings.

Dodd graduated from Garfield High School at the age of 15, and from Wilson Business College at 16. She got her first job at a local lumber company, as a secretary. In 1931, she got married and the couple had two children. During World War II, Dodd worked as the head clerk for the local food rationing board. She then worked as a portfolio clerk in the investment department of Pacific National Bank (now Wells Fargo Bank).

Dodd passed away in Seattle, Washington, USA, on 13 August 2019, at the age of 110 years, 42 days. She was survived by her two children, 4 grandchildren, and 4 great-grandchildren. At the time of death, she was the fourth-oldest known living person in the U.S. state of Washington, behind Ruth ApiladoGertrude Ellison, and LaVerne Bunney.

LongeviQuest is pleased to announce the age validation of Ruth Anna Victoria Brown of the United States at age 110. She was born in Pittsburgh, Allegheny County, Pennsylvania, United States on 14 June 1913 to Swedish immigrants. She is the eldest of 10 siblings.

Brown married her husband on 28 May 1938 and had two daughters. In the 1960s, she moved to Oberlin, Ohio with her husband. After her husband’s passing in 1990, she moved to Texas to live with her daughter Kristine, who died in 2015. Brown, then aged 102, moved to a retirement facility in Nashua, Hillsborough County, New Hampshire, to be closer to her daughter Bonnie, who resided in Massachusetts.

At the time of her 108th birthday in 2021, Brown had five grandchildren and seven great-grandchildren. She attributed taking cod liver oil daily as a secret to her longevity. At age 109, her hearing had deteriorated, but was still reported to be in perfect health. At her age of 110, she is considered as New Hampshire’s oldest known resident.
